Fine-Tuning Product Regimens for Warmer Days
Among one of the most reliable means to rejuvenate a skincare protocol is by rethinking the products your clients utilize daily. As temperatures increase, heavy occlusive products may no longer serve them well. Consider recommending lighter hydration and switching from abundant creams to gel-based or water-based choices.
Cleansing is an additional vital location where subtle adjustments can make a considerable difference. In the springtime, the skin may produce even more oil and sweat, particularly with boosted activity and time outdoors. Suggest balancing cleansers that support the skin obstacle while completely eliminating impurities. Encourage customers to prevent severe stripping items, which can set off more oil manufacturing and sensitivity.
Obviously, SPF is non-negotiable year-round, but springtime is an optimal time to double down on sunlight security. With longer daytime hours and more time spent outside, a broad-spectrum SPF needs to belong to every morning regimen. Offer clients choices that really feel light-weight and breathable to sustain everyday wear.

Addressing Seasonal Skin Stressors Head-On
Spring isn't simply sunshine and roses. It likewise brings seasonal allergies, boosted plant pollen, and a higher likelihood of inflammation or flare-ups. As a positive skincare professional, prepare for these problems and construct preventative procedures into your customer methods.
Try to find signs of animated skin, such as soreness, dryness, or itching, especially in customers prone to seasonal allergies. Concentrate on soothing ingredients and obstacle support. Advise way of life changes, such as cleaning the face after being outdoors, to decrease irritant exposure.
Hydration continues to be essential, even as moisture rises. Yet hydration doesn't need to mean hefty. Encourage using hydrating mists, lotions with hyaluronic acid, and light-weight lotions that soak up quickly while maintaining the skin plump.

Making Protocol Adjustments Personal
No 2 skins are alike, which indicates no two spring protocols should be identical. Utilize this seasonal change as a chance to reconnect with clients on a personal degree. Deal spring skin check-ins or mini-consultations to evaluate progress and make thoughtful adjustments.
Pay attention to their concerns. Are they feeling oily? Breaking out extra? Seeing pigmentation or redness? Utilize their comments to direct your adjustments. You could suggest incorporating active ingredients like niacinamide for soothing, vitamin C for brightening, or light-weight antioxidants to sustain skin during raised sun direct exposure.
